ospf協議中,什麼是lsa,它在路由器中的作用是什麼

2021-03-06 04:39:27 字數 5853 閱讀 3882

1樓:匿名使用者

lsa是鏈路狀態通告,它在路由器中又分為6類通告,每類通告在**用的上,很複雜!

1、路由器lsa (router lsa)

由區域內所有路由器產生,並且只能在本個區域內泛洪廣播。

這些最基本的lsa通告列出了路由器所有的鏈路和介面,並指明瞭它們的狀態和沿每條鏈路方向出站的代價。

2、網路lsa (***work lsa)

由區域內的dr或bdr路由器產生,報文包括dr和bdr連線的路由器的鏈路資訊。

網路lsa也僅僅在產生這條網路lsa的區域內部進行泛洪。

3、網路彙總lsa (***work summary lsa)

由abr產生,可以通知本區域內的路由器通往區域外的路由資訊。

在一個區域外部但是仍然在一個ospf自治系統內部的預設路由也可以通過這種lsa來通告。

如果一臺abr路由器經過骨幹區域從其他的abr路由器收到多條網路彙總lsa,那麼這臺始發的abr路由器將會選擇這些lsa通告中代價最低的lsa,並且將這個lsa的最低代價通告給與它相連的非骨幹區域。

4、asbr彙總lsa (asbr summary lsa)

也是由abr產生,但是它是一條主機路由,指向asbr路由器地址的路由。

5、自治系統外部lsa (autonomous system external lsa)

由asbr產生,告訴相同自治區的路由器通往外部自治區的路徑。

自治系統外部lsa是惟一不和具體的區域相關聯的lsa通告,將在整個自治系統中進行泛洪。

6、nssa外部lsa (nssa external lsa)

由asbr產生,幾乎和lsa 5通告是相同的,但nssa外部lsa通告僅僅在始發這個nssa外部lsa通告的非純末梢區域內部進行泛洪。

在nssa區域中,當有一個路由器是asbr時,不得不產生lsa 5報文,但是nssa中不能有lsa 5報文,所有asbr產生lsa 7報文,發給本區域的路由器。

大致就是這樣幾個知識點....

2樓:笑掉假牙

簡單地說,就是路由

器把自己的鏈路,介面,頻寬情況等等,放到lsa裡面,然後發給其他路由器,其他路由器再用lsa裡面的資訊計算路由。常用的1,2,3,4,5,7類lsa,好好看看吧,不難理解。

手機打字辛苦,希望能採納,謝謝!

3樓:匿名使用者

lsa 鏈路狀態通告,有六個型別 lsa1 lsa2 lsa3 lsa4 lsa5 lsa7 每種型別宣告的內容都不一樣,各有各的作用。

4樓:匿名使用者

lsa是鏈路狀態通告,全稱是link state advertisement,分為

type1---router lsa

type2---***work lsa

type3 type4 ---summary lsa(type 4為asbr summary lsa)

type5 ----external lsatype7 ----nssa lsa

他們的作用和泛洪區域不同,ospf就是利用這些lsa來計算路由的

5樓:匿名使用者

ospf協議的重點之一,非常重要,好好看看吧

在ospf中型別2的lsa有什麼用?它並不用來生成路由,是幹什麼用的?

6樓:巛巛巜巜巜

2類lsa只存在於多路訪問網路,用於描述網路拓撲1類lsa的內容:本路由器的直連鄰居,直連線口的資訊2類lsa的內容:多路訪問介面地址的掩碼、介面互連的所有路由器在多路訪問網路中,不需要每臺裝置去描述多路訪問介面,只需要dr來描述即可

假設有n臺裝置接入多路訪問網路,如果用lsa1去描述,即每臺裝置都產生lsa1,那麼就會有n條lsa1,如果用lsa2去描述,則只需1條。

關於ospf協議中lsa的傳遞範圍?

7樓:汐晨若風

aospf lsa型別

1.型別1:router lsa:每個路由器都將產生router lsa,這種lsa只在本區域內傳播,描述了路由器所有的鏈路和介面,狀態和開銷.

2.型別2:***work lsa:

在每個多路訪問網路中,dr都會產生這種***work lsa,它只在產生這條***work lsa的區域泛洪描述了所有和它相連的路由器(包括dr本身)。

3.型別3:***work summary

lsa:由abr路由器始發,用於通告該區域外部的目的地址.當其他的路由器收到來自abr的***work summary

lsa以後,它不會執行spf演算法,它只簡單的加上到達那個abr的開銷和***work summary

lsa中包含的開銷,通過abr,到達目標地址的路由和開銷一起被加進路由表裡,這種依賴中間路由器來確定到達目標地址的完全路由(full

route)實際上是距離向量路由協議的行為。

4.型別4:asbr summary lsa:由abr發出,asbr彙總lsa除了所通告的目的地是一個asbr而不是一個網路外,其他同***work summary lsa.

5.型別5:as external lsa:

發自asbr路由器,用來通告到達ospf自治系統外部的目的地,或者ospf自治系統那個外部的預設路由的lsa.這種lsa將在全as內泛洪(4個特殊區域除外)

6.型別6:group membership lsa

7.型別7:nssa external lsa:

來自非完全stub區域(not-so-stubby area)內asbr路由器始發的lsa通告它只在nssa區域內泛洪,這是與lsa-type5的區別.

8.型別8:external attributes lsa

9.型別9:opaque lsa(link-local scope,)

10.型別10:opaque lsa(area-local scope)

11.型別11:opaque lsa(as scope)

ospf協議中lsa包含哪些資訊?lsa摘要包含哪些資訊?

8樓:笑掉假牙

lsa是由lsa頭部和lsa內容構成的,所有的lsa頭部結構都是一樣的,只是具體的內容不一樣,比如lsa-id和lsa-type不同,其它的可以先不考慮。

不同的lsa內容是不同的,常用的幾個說一下吧:

router-lsa,每個路由器都會產生,描述路由器自身的鏈路情況,比如連了哪些網段

***work-lsa 這是dr產生的,描述一個網段內有哪些路由器

summary-lsa 由abr產生,描述一跳區域間路由

asbr-summary lsa,由abr產生,描述如何到達asbr

external-las 由asbr產生,描述一跳外部路由

nssa-lsa 由nssa區域的asbr產生,作用與上面的類似,但範圍僅限於一個nssa區域

這是回答第一個問題,下面說第二個問題:

在ospf鄰居建立的過程中,會有一個階段——exchange,在這個階段,兩臺路由器之間會互動資訊,每一臺路由器都會發dbd報文,這個報文會告訴對方,我有哪些lsa,怎麼表示我有哪些lsa呢?這時候就到用lsa的頭部了,因為一個lsa的頭部可以唯一地表示一個lsa。dbd就是自己擁有的所有lsa的頭部,也就是你說的lsa摘要。

舉個例子,比如一個班有30個學生,每個學生有自己的名字、成績和排名,當這個班的老師跟別的老師聊天時,就可以簡單地說自己班裡有30個學生,名字是***,***,……。這就是摘要,而不用說出每個學生的所有資訊。

希望能幫到你。

9樓:匿名使用者

這樣做是為了減少路由器之間傳遞資訊的量,因為lsa的head只佔一條lsa的整個內容包括所需要的lsa的摘要。 lsu報文(link state update packet):用來向

lsa是什麼?和ospf的關係?

10樓:匿名使用者

其實不用想的這麼複雜,通俗點理解,lsa 鏈路狀態資訊 他裡面包含的就是該路由器周圍,也可以說是直連的一些路由資訊,然後將該lsa已廣播的形式傳送給周圍執行了ospf的路由器,然後那個路由器在計算路由,然後重新生成lsa,然後再廣播傳送給周圍路由器。直到整個ospf區域的路由器都有相同的lsa列表。

當然這只是很簡單的說法,具體的話是很難一下說明清楚的,因為lsa還分為很多種,ospf也可以是多區域,不同的lsa和區域,還是有區別的。不必深究~~

11樓:笑掉假牙

得先說一下rip和ospf的區別,rip是距離向量型協議,rip的鄰居之間交換的是路由表,直接獲得路由,而ospf是鏈路狀態型協議,ospf鄰居之間交換的是拓撲資訊,它們根據拓撲資訊自己計算路由。這是他們的根本區別。

lsa就是ospf用來發布和更新拓撲資訊的一個東西。

說一下單區域下的情況,便於理解:

對於每一臺執行了ospf的路由器來說,一旦有介面up起來,它就會產生lsa,把自身的一些拓撲資訊放到lsa裡面,這些資訊包括自己連了哪些網路,子網,掩碼,開銷等等。

然後發給自己的鄰居,鄰居再傳遞給自己的其它的鄰居。

比如區域內有a,b,c三個路由器,a產生一個lsa,b產生一個lsa,c產生一個lsa

最終的結果是每臺路由器都這三條lsa,這三條lsa就構成了lsdb.

每個lsa代表一部分拓撲資訊,當lsa聚集起來,就包括了整個網路的拓撲資訊。

然後路由器就會利用lsdb,根據spf演算法,來計算路由。

因為它知道整個網路的拓撲,它就知道網路內的每一個網段,開銷等等,所以計算出路由是沒有問題的。

當拓撲發生變化的時候,相關的路由器就會再傳送lsa來更新拓撲情況,然後路由器再重新計算路由。

多區域的時候,ospf會有更多種類的lsa,可以看一下。

這就是lsa的本質和作用,希望能幫到你。

12樓:cz濤聲依舊

lsa在ospf中是通過鏈路狀態用的,ospf路由器中有個lsdb,是lsa的集合!更具這個lsdb才能計算出spf,也就是最好的路徑,三類lsa是一個分組

常用的lsa有

1,2,3,4,5,6,7類lsa,你可以分別去查下,我寫出來太多

13樓:匿名使用者

看c**p的bsci吧

ospf中有幾種lsa,各有什麼作用

14樓:

lsa的型別:一共11種

1、router lsa 通告啟用了ospf介面的cost值,網段資訊,router id(不能夠通告的區域外)每一臺路 由器都會通告

【h3c】display ospf lsdb router

2、***work lsa 只有dr進行通告 不同網段的資訊

【h3c】display ospf lsdb ***work

3、***work summary lsa 由abr進行通告 域間路由

【h3c】display ospf lsdb summary

4、asbr-summary lsa 由abr進行通告 告訴asbr的位置(asbr的router id)

【h3c】display ospf lsdb asbr

5、as external lsa 外部lsa 由asbr進行通告的 通告是外部路由

【h3c】display ospf lsdb ase

6、組播lsa mospf 組播ospf

7、nssa lsa 非完全末梢區域lsa

【h3c】display ospf lsdb nssa

只能在nssa區域中看到,到達其他區域會被abr翻譯

8、mp-bgp的lsa

9、ospf的graceful restart 優雅重啟

10、ospf支援te流量工程

11、opaque lsa (as範圍)

LSA是什麼?和OSPF的關係

其實不用想的這麼複雜,通俗點理解,lsa 鏈路狀態資訊 他裡面包含的就是該路由器周圍,也可以說是直連的一些路由資訊,然後將該lsa已廣播的形式傳送給周圍執行了ospf的路由器,然後那個路由器在計算路由,然後重新生成lsa,然後再廣播傳送給周圍路由器。直到整個ospf區域的路由器都有相同的lsa列表。...

什麼是OSPF什麼是OSPF協議它有什麼作用

ospf意思是指一個內部閘道器協議 interior gateway protocol,簡稱igp 用於在單一自治系統內決策路由。ospf主要通過一個鏈路狀態路由協議來實現,該協議隸屬於內部閘道器協議 igp 因此在自治系統內執行。ospf分為ospfv2和ospfv3兩個版本,其中ospfv2用在...

ospf的優點是什麼ospf協議的優點是什麼

ospf是一個內部閘道器協議 interior gateway protocol,簡稱igp 用於在單一自治系統 autonomous system,as 內決策路由。是對鏈路狀態路由協議的一種實現,隸屬內部閘道器協議 igp 故運作於自治系統內部。ospf路由協議是一種典型的鏈路狀態 link s...